HUB
Acting
Rorie Stockton
*1970
in Swansea, Wales, United Kingdom
The Doll Under the Stairs
2024
4/10
Night of the Living Dead: Resurrection
2012
7/10
Borstal
2017
4/10
The Doll Master
2018
2/10
Viral Beauty
2018